Patterson, Hicks miss Bears practice Wednesday

Bears receiver/running back Cordarrelle Patterson (knee), defensive tackle Akiem Hicks (ankle) and tight end Demetrius Harris (foot) sat out practice Wednesday.

Head coach Matt Nagy said Monday Patterson would be day-to-day this week. Patterson suffered the injury Sunday against the Vikings. He was just voted into the Pro Bowl as a kick returner.

"I hope that he's able to go," Nagy said. "We're kind of at that point right now where you're at the end of the year and there's a bunch of bumps and bruises."

Also, three defensive backs remained out of practice Wednesday due to injuries. Jaylon Johnson (shoulder), Buster Skrine (concussion) and Deon Bush (foot) all sat out practice. All three missed Sunday's game against the Minnesota Vikings.

Defensive backs Kindle Vildor and Duke Shelley saw significant playing time Sunday with those three out.

The Bears moved practice indoors Wednesday and did a walk-through, rather than a full padded practice. Nagy said he simply wanted his players to get a little more rest during this late stage of the season.
